E price of a large pizza increased from $21 to $26. what is the percent of increase in the cost of pizza? round to the nearest p
rodikova [14]
Percent increase=increase/original times 100

increase=26-21=5
original=21

so
5/21 times 100=0.23809523809523809523809523809524 times 100=23.809523809523809523809523809524
round
24%

so 24% increase
